Wesley Chapel Cemetery Restoration and Workshop
Friday, June 3, 2016

Sponsored by the Warren County Genealogical Society


The 8th annual Cemetery Restoration Clinic was a great success with over 30 participants including a number of descendants of those buried in the cemetery. Walt and Micki Walters from the Graveyard Groomer presented an outstanding program.  We are grateful for the time and effort devoted to the workshop by chairman Terry Easton for the Warren County Genealogical Society and the support for the workshop provided by Bruce Barricklow as well as the trustees and employees of Harlan Township.

The primary purpose of the clinic was to educate those attending.  In the morning, the clinic presented graphic demonstrations on suitable restoration techniques to deal with various problems experienced in older cemeteries and provided commentary on the cause of those problems both in the past and continuing today. In the afternoon, those attending the clinic had the opportunity to put those techniques to use, with varying amounts of work done on over 40 different gravestone in the cemetery. Each participant received a heavily illustrated 162 page workbook covering all of the topics addressed during the clinic.  Those who weren't able to attend may purchase a copy of the workbook from the Warren County Genealogical Society [513 695 1444 or [email protected]] for only $20 plus $2 shipping and handling.
